Tobacco Spatial Data Intelligent Visual Analysis

Author:

Yang BoORCID,Tian Dong,Shan GuihuaORCID

Abstract

A multi-module visualization framework is designed and a visual analysis system called TobaccoGeoVis is implemented to analyze tobacco spatial data efficiently. The proposed system provides a visualization technology for overlaying multiple graphics on a map to enrich the form of tobacco spatial data visualization. The system also adopts artificial intelligence algorithms and multi-view linkage interactive methods and provides flexible data-attribute field mapping and graphical parameter configuration to analyze tobacco spatial data. We demonstrated that the system is user-friendly and the applied visualization methods are effective using cases selected from the three sets of data.
